Police say a man stole money from poor boxes at a church in Massapequa.
They say Mark Spruill used a rock to smash open the poor boxes at Our Lady of Lourdes Church on Carmans Road Thursday. He entered the church through an unlocked door.
The Amityville man is accused of taking cash out of the boxes and running off.
Spruill is charged with burglary, petit larceny, criminal mischeif and possession of burglar tools.
Police say they believe Spruill burglarized the church at least four times dating back to December 2009.
Monsignor Jim Lisante says he just prays he gets help. "He didn't need to, all he had to do was ask for help and we would have given it to him, so it's sad anyone was lead to do that," Lisante said.
Spruill is being held on $25,000 bond and is due back on court on Dec. 16.
